Canadian Goldilocks

The "Goldilocks" were a RCAF acrobatic display team that flew Harvard aircraft in the early 1960s. The name was a parody of the better know "Golden Hawks".

I have been meaning to do something for some time to try and get myself back into the hobby, as I haven't done any modeling now for years. Repainting the Fiddlers Green Harvard in Goldilocks colors seemed like an easy way to do that, and posting the results of that here will (hopefully) motivate me to actually print it out and build it.
